Meet Us: King Arthur Baking Company has been sharing the joy of baking since 1790. Headquartered in Norwich, Vermont, we’re the ultimate baking resource – providing education, inspiration, and the highest quality products, all while fostering connections and community through baking. Our superior flours and mixes are available in supermarkets nationwide, and our direct-to-consumer business – website and retail stores – offers an even wider selection of specialty baking ingredients, mixes, gluten-free products, baking tools, and more. We bring baking education to millions of bakers through our cookbooks, podcast, recipe app, website, and baking school. We’re proud to be 100% employee-owned, which means everyone who works here has a real voice and a shared stake in what we do. This creates a strong sense of community built on trust, teamwork, and love of baking. As a benefit corporation, we’re committed to the best interests of all our stakeholders - employees, our local communities, our broader community of bakers, and our planet. The Position: The Supply Chain Analyst is responsible for delivering reporting, analytics, and business intelligence solutions that improve visibility, data integrity, and decision-making across the Supply Chain organization. Through data analysis, KPI governance, and insight generation, this role helps identify risks, opportunities, and performance drivers that support operational and strategic business objectives.

Essential Duties And Responsibilities

  • Proactively identify trends, risks, opportunities, and performance drivers through analysis of internal and external data sources, translating findings into actionable business recommendations.
  • Conduct recurring and ad hoc analyses and develop executive-level insights that translate complex supply chain data to answer key business questions.
  • Develop and maintain reporting, dashboards, KPIs, and analytical tools that provide actionable visibility into Supply Chain performance and support data-driven decision-making.
  • Conduct scenario modeling and analytical assessments to support end-to-end supply chain strategy, capacity planning, network optimization, and risk management.
  • Identify operational efficiency and cost optimization opportunities through evaluation of supply chain performance, processes, and network operations.
  • Partner with Supply Planning, Sourcing, Operations, Finance, IT, and Business Process Improvement teams to provide analytical support, testing, and business insights related to reporting and planning systems.
  • Establish and maintain reporting definitions, KPI governance, and data validation processes that improve visibility and ensure consistency and trust in business reporting.
  • Serve as the subject matter expert for Supply Chain data structures, reporting architecture, and analytics tools, providing insights and decision support across the organization.
  • Diagnose data quality issues, reporting discrepancies, and planning system exceptions to improve data reliability, and analytical accuracy.
  • Support organizational capability development through analytical training, reporting resources, and self-service business intelligence tools.

Experience And Education

  • 3–5 years of experience in Supply Chain, Supply Planning, Business Analytics, Manufacturing, Procurement, Operations Planning, or related disciplines.
  • Strong understanding of inventory planning, supply planning, manufacturing, procurement, and distribution processes.
  • Experience developing reports, dashboards, and business intelligence solutions using Power BI, Tableau, or similar analytics platforms.
  • Experience working with structured and unstructured data sources, including data extraction, cleansing, modeling, and validation.
  • Experience working with ERP and planning systems; SAP S/4HANA experience preferred.
  • Experience with Power Query, DAX, SQL, Python, R, or similar analytical tools preferred.
  • Experience leveraging modern analytics and AI-enabled technologies, including machine learning, predictive analytics, Microsoft Copilot, Fabric, or similar decision-support tools preferred.
